Best areas to stay in York

York is a vibrant city with a rich tapestry of history, charm, and distinct neighborhoods that cater to different tastes. Each district offers its unique vibe, appealing to various types of travelers, from families to solo adventurers. Whether you prefer the hustle of the city center or the tranquility of a riverside spot, York has accommodations for every style.

City Centre

The heart of York features iconic landmarks like the York Minster and the Shambles. This bustling area offers easy access to shops, restaurants, and attractions. Hotels here range from lavish chains to cozy boutique stays.

  • Middleton's Hotel - Traditional decor in a prime location.
  • Hotel du Vin York - Stylish rooms in a former warehouse.
  • The Principal York - Luxurious stay with a beautiful garden.
  • The Judges Lodging - A historic hotel with rich furnishings.
Bootham

Located just north of the city center, Bootham is known for its stunning architecture and proximity to museums. This area is perfect for travelers looking for a quieter, yet convenient stay.

  • Grays Court - A historic, intimate hotel near the Minster.
  • The Holgate Bridge - A cozy spot with a personal touch.
  • York Pavilion Hotel - Boutique hotel with garden views.
Southbank

Southbank, situated along the River Ouse, offers a mix of residential charm and riverside walks. It’s ideal for those wanting a relaxed atmosphere yet close enough to the city buzz.

  • Best Western York Pavilion Hotel - Victorian-style hotel near the river.
  • Malone's Hotel - Simple and welcoming, perfect for families.
Fulford

A bit further out, Fulford provides a more suburban feel while still being within easy reach of central York. It's great for those who enjoy parks and peace.

Average hotel prices in York

Hotel prices in York can vary significantly depending on the location, type, and season. Generally, you can find various options ranging from budget hostels to luxury hotels, ensuring there’s something for everyone. Expect higher rates during peak tourist seasons, such as summer and holidays, while winter months may offer better deals.

  • Budget Hotels: €60 - €100 per night. Popular choices include hostels and simple inns.
  • Mid-Range Hotels: €100 - €200 per night. This category features comfortable hotels with amenities.
  • Luxury Hotels: €200 - €500+ per night. High-end options with elegant facilities are available.
  • Family-Friendly Hotels: €80 - €250 per night. These often include extra beds or family rooms.
  • Unique Stays: €100 - €400 per night. Boutique lodgings with character.
  • Guesthouses/B&Bs: €70 - €150 per night. Charming places ideal for local experiences.
  • Taxes: Typically, tourist taxes range from 0% to 20% depending on the hotel class.
  • Breakfast: Some hotels include it, while others may charge extra, often around €10.
